CARIA, Antioch ad Maeandrum. Early-Mid 1st century BC. AR Tetradrachm (27.5mm, 16.17 g, 12h). Diotrephes, magistrate. Head of Apollo right, wearing laurel wreath; bow and quiver over shoulder / Zebu bull standing left, head facing; ANTIOXEΩN above, ΔIOTPEΦHΣ/ TO TETAP/ TON in exergue; all within circular maeander pattern. Thonemann Group A, 3, a var. (O5/R– [unlisted rev. die]); HN Online 2314. Lightly toned, pitting, scattered marks and scratches. Near VF. Very rare.
